Grace period ending for rental property owners

March 13, 2019 in Community

Rental property owners in Kansas City who have not received a permit under the new Healthy Homes Rental Inspection Program will begin facing penalties after March 31. In August 2018, Kansas City joined a number of other cities around the country in adopting a rental inspection program through an initiative petition. The petition was approved […]

First-Time Homebuyer Savings Account Accessible to Missourians

February 1, 2019 in Government Affairs

Thanks to the effort of Missouri REALTORS®, first-time homebuyers in Missouri have a new tool to help them purchase their first home. Called “Missouri First Home,” these First-Time Homebuyer Savings accounts were approved by the legislature and signed by the Governor in 2018.
